More shed time last weekend meant it was time for the rear disk brake "bolt on" kit ... turns out it wasn't as "bolt on" as expected.

Turns out i only had the trim a little corner off the mounting flange on the rear axel housing to get the brackets to fit, i didn't want to trim the bracket as they're already quite thin in that area to clear the housing. Didn't get pics of this part sorry, was too busy being fascinated by how easy it was to pull the Dif apart to get the axels out. Having never played with a Dif before i was surprised just how well it all came apart (and want back together).
